Central sensitization is a condition in which the nervous system becomes overly sensitive to pain signals causing even mild stimuli to be perceived as painful. This does not mean the pain is imaginary or psychological. Instead, it is a documented biological recalibration of the central nervous system’s pain threshold.


Prolonged nociceptive input rewires neural networks to amplify pain signals essentially turning up the volume on pain. As a result, pain can spread beyond the original injury site (bullionbank.co.kr) and persist even after healing has occurred.


This condition is commonly seen in disorders including fibromyalgia, tension-type headaches, functional bowel syndromes, and long-term spinal discomfort. It is not caused by ongoing tissue damage but rather by maladaptive neuroplasticity that distorts pain signaling.


People with central sensitization often report that everyday activities like light touch, temperature changes, or even noise and bright lights can become uncomfortable or painful.


The good news is that neural hypersensitivity can be effectively modulated, even after years of chronic symptoms. Treatment typically involves a comprehensive care plan integrating body and mind therapies.


One key component is education. Understanding that the pain is real but not caused by ongoing damage can reduce fear and anxiety, which often worsen symptoms.


Physical therapy plays an important role. Systematic, low-intensity activity reprograms the brain’s pain interpretation. Activities like walking, swimming, or yoga that are done consistently and without pushing into severe pain can restore normal sensory processing.


Cognitive behavioral therapy is also highly effective. It helps individuals modify maladaptive beliefs about pain and build resilience tools. Mindfulness and relaxation techniques can decrease sympathetic overdrive and promote parasympathetic balance.


Medications may be used carefully in some cases. Some neuromodulating drugs like SNRIs and gabapentinoids target central pain amplification, not mood or seizures. Opioid therapy is strongly advised against as they exacerbate central sensitization and increase long-term pain vulnerability.


Lifestyle factors matter too. Good sleep, stress reduction, and a healthy diet all support nervous system regulation. Avoiding refined sugars, alcohol, and artificial additives can make a measurable reduction in symptom burden.


Recovery from central sensitization is often slow and requires patience. Progress is not always linear. There may be periods of improvement interspersed with setbacks, but with consistent effort, the nervous system can reset its sensitivity baseline.


Working with a a multidisciplinary clinic experienced in central sensitization is essential. With the personalized protocols and ongoing guidance, many people find that their symptoms diminish markedly and daily functioning rebounds.
